Medical Oxygen in Emergency Situations

In emergency medical care, the availability of oxygen can mean the difference between life and death. During traumatic events such as car accidents, heart attacks, or strokes, oxygen helps maintain adequate oxygenation to vital organs, ensuring the brain, heart, and other critical systems function properly. Paramedics and emergency response teams are often equipped with portable oxygen tanks, allowing them to administer immediate treatment to patients in distress.


Emergencies like respiratory distress, drowning, or poisoning also require urgent oxygen therapy to stabilize breathing. In these cases, oxygen is administered as soon as possible to help the body recover from a potentially life-threatening lack of oxygen.


Medical Oxygen in Chronic Illness Management

For patients suffering from chronic illnesses like Chronic Obstructive Pulmonary Disease (COPD), asthma, or pulmonary fibrosis, medical oxygen becomes a long-term solution. These conditions often reduce the lungs' ability to absorb enough oxygen from the air, making supplemental oxygen necessary for daily life.


Oxygen therapy helps improve patients' quality of life by alleviating symptoms such as shortness of breath, fatigue, and confusion caused by low oxygen levels. In turn, this can allow patients to maintain a more active lifestyle and prevent complications such as heart failure.


Advances in oxygen concentrators and portable oxygen tanks have made it easier for chronic illness patients to receive oxygen therapy at home. This helps reduce hospital visits and allows patients to manage their condition more independently, while still receiving the life-sustaining oxygen they need.
